Condensation between the panes is another frequent issue when using double glazing. This could be due to a failure of the seal that allows moisture to build up between two glass panels. This can be very unattractive and can be a hassle for homeowners. However, it is usually simple and quick repair that can be done without the need for a new window.

Double glazing that is misted can be repaired by replacing the window seals or re-sealing the glass. This will allow gas to flow between the panes and prevent any moisture from leaking into the house. This kind of repair costs only a few dollars and should be done quickly to avoid further damage or loss of efficiency.

UPVC conservatories and orangeries are designed to last, however, they can be damaged by weather or wear and tear. The good news is that you can repair these issues without having to completely replace your extension or windows.

Leaks are the most frequent issue with UPVC conservatories. They can be caused by a variety of issues, ranging from condensation to poor sealing, so it's vital to act immediately when you spot an issue. If you see the possibility of a leak in a particular area of your conservatory, you could usually reseal that part of the roof. This will prevent further water from getting in.

Condensation and draughts are another issue that homeowners have to deal with when using UPVC double-glazing. It is typically caused by a damaged seal between the glass panes which can lead to the development of moisture and a hazy appearance. In our survey, we found that three of ten homeowners who installed their double glazing themselves reported problems following installation. These included doors and windows that become difficult to close or open or drop or sag over time so they don't work as well.

These problems can sometimes be fixed by oiling hinges, mechanisms, and handles - or in certain situations, areas where the window or door passes through the frame (for example if you have a uPVC sliding patio door). If your frames are swollen, you can also wipe them down with cold water during periods of extreme heat and moisture.

If, however, your uPVC patio door doesn't lock or the lock mechanism is damaged, this will need to be replaced. Depending on the type of patio door, this could cost between PS900 and PS1,500.
